The first card that I made was the cardinal card. Beforehand, I stamped the Whisper White panel with the large snowflake stamp from the October Paper Pumpkin kit using Versamark Ink and sprinkled it with clear embossing powder. I heat set the snowflakes, giving a shiny but subtle texture to the white background. I adhered it to a Thick Whisper White card base with dimensionals. I adhered the Silver Foil panel in the upper center with dimensionals and adhered the cardinal with glue dots. That’s it! I used the Celebrate the Season sentiment from the Itty Bitty Christmas stamp set for the inside. I silver embossed it on a Whisper White panel and adhered it to the inside of the card.

This is the second card that I made in the video. I used the stamps from the October Paper Pumpkin kit to stamp the label and inside greetings in Shaded Spruce and the little cardinal in Poppy Parade. I started by embossing a Whisper White panel with the Pinewood Planks embossing folder. This picks up on the wood grain theme in the circle of the red tag. I adhered the embossed panel to a Pool Party card base with liquid glue. I added the Shaded Spruce ribbon and Silver cord to the top per the kit instructions. I adhered a small snowflake and two holly leaves and a sprig with the glue dots that came with the kit. I adhered the deer with dimensionals. I stamped the label with the Seasons Greetings sentiment in Shaded Spruce and adhered it with dimensionals.

I finished the tag with silver sequins from the kit and red rhinestones from my stash. Then I adhered the tag to the card front with dimensionals. On the inside, I trimmed a Whisper White panel on the bottom with one of the strips of wood grain paper from the October kit and stamped the sentiment and a little cardinal.

Cardstock Cuts for this project:
- Cardinal Card
- Thick Whisper White – 4 1/4″ x 11″ (card base)
- Whisper White – 4″ x 5 1/4″ (embossed front) , 3 3/4″ x 5″ (inside)
- Silver Foil – 2 1/4″ x 2 1/2″
- Deer Tag Card
- Pool Party – 5 1/2″ x 8 1/2″ (card base)
- Whisper White – (2) 3 3/4″ x 5″ (embossed panel and inside panel)
